Forensic Accountant - Regulatory EnforcementLocation: Central Birmingham (Hybrid: 4 days per fortnight in office)
Salary: £91,000 + Excellent Benefits (including 10% pension)
Position: Permanent
Goodman Masson are partnered with a UK regulatory body to recruit an experienced Forensic Accountant. This organisation plays a critical public-interest role by overseeing high standards in corporate governance, financial reporting, and audit.
Working within their independent Enforcement Division, you will lead complex financial investigations into potential misconduct, auditing failures, and accounting breaches. This role offers high visibility, regular collaboration with major statutory authorities (such as the SFO and FCA), and direct oversight of significant enforcement casework.
Key Responsibilities
• Lead Financial Investigations: Manage avenues of enquiry, analyse massive volumes of financial data, and utilise electronic review platforms on high-profile cases.
• Conduct Disciplinary Interviews: Prepare for and lead formal, technical interviews with subject partners and senior industry figures.
• Draft Expert Reports: Produce comprehensive investigation reports to form the core basis of instructions for external legal counsel and independent experts.
• Cross-Agency Collaboration: Work alongside case lawyers to liaise and share vital intelligence with external regulatory bodies.
• Mentorship: Provide technical guidance, coaching, and development to line management and junior investigative staff.
The Ideal Profile
• Qualifications: Fully qualified accountant (ACA, ACCA, or equivalent).
• Experience: Indicatively 6-12 years of specialised experience in forensic accounting and complex financial investigations.
• Technical Skills: Proven expertise in e-discovery tools, financial data analysis, and a solid understanding of audit standards and regulatory disciplinary processes.
• Communication: Exceptional capability to translate complex financial findings into clear written and verbal evidence for non-accounting audiences.
Package & Benefits
• Annual Leave: 30 days leave + flexible bank holidays (option to purchase additional leave).
• Pension: 10% employer contribution.
• Work-Life Balance: Strong commitment to flexible hybrid working (4 days per fortnight required in office).
